Output 417498e36ddc499fd1dda352cda3daafd7e2c98e829996d92682fa7003a457ce:0

value
18745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b590eb5d9e3dc1ec382d4adf8b6337c54abca77 OP_EQUAL
address
MDJxnZxrhWZWCBUd81eoNbEYtY8TD5PhMW
transaction
417498e36ddc499fd1dda352cda3daafd7e2c98e829996d92682fa7003a457ce
spent
true